Product description

The MLX91211 is a second-generation medium-speed current sensor that senses the magnetic field generated by the current flowing through a conductor, be it a cable, a bus bar or a PCB trace.

To minimize the susceptibility to external magnetic fields and maximizing the concentration of the magnetic field generated by the current flow, the sensor is typically placed inside a ferromagnetic core.

The sensor has an analog output ratiometric to its supply voltage (which can be in the range of 3.135 V to 5.5 V). The MLX91211 contains a voltage regulator for stable internal supply and optimum performances.

The output is proportional to the sensed magnetic field perpendicular to the package surface.

The device is pre-programmed with different sensitivity settings as a function of different current sensing ranges and features a factory-calibrated quiescent output voltage at 50% of the supply voltage.

The sensor is optimized for cost-sensitive applications, and comes in 2 variants:

- the ABT version with multi-temperature trimming of the sensitivity, and high accuracy
- the ABA version with default trimming, and standard accuracy

Features and benefits

  • Linear Hall sensor optimized for AC and DC current sensing applications

  • Supply voltage in the range of 3.135 V to 5.5 V

  • Analog ratiometric output voltage

  • Factory trimmed magnetic sensitivity and offset

  • Medium speed sensing

    • DC to 40 kHz bandwidth

    • < 10 µs response time

  • Fast startup time enabling power gating

  • Miniature packages RoHS compliant & Green

    • TSOT-3L (SE) surface mount

    • TO92-3L (UA) through hole mount

  • Suitable for lead free soldering profile up to 260 °C, MSL3 (SE) and MSL1 (UA)

  • AEC-Q100 automotive qualified
